Metal Downspout Installation in San Francisco, CA
Metal downspout installation services involve fitting durable metal pipes to direct rainwater away from a property’s foundation and exterior walls. These installations typically cover residential projects such as replacing old or damaged downspouts, adding new systems to improve drainage, or upgrading existing gutters for better performance. Property owners often want to understand the types of metals available, such as aluminum or steel, and how the chosen materials will complement their home’s exterior. Additionally, understanding the proper placement and size of downspouts can help ensure effective water management and prevent potential water damage.
Before requesting metal downspout installation, homeowners should consider the overall drainage layout of their property and whether existing gutters need repairs or upgrades. It’s also helpful to know the scope of the project, including the number of downspouts required and any specific aesthetic preferences. Clear communication about the property’s roof size, rainfall levels, and landscape features can assist in selecting the most suitable materials and configurations. Proper planning ensures the installation effectively manages water runoff and contributes to the longevity of the home’s exterior.

Metal Downspout Installation Questions
What are the benefits of metal downspout installation? Metal downspouts provide durable, long-lasting protection against water damage and help direct rainwater away from the foundation.
What types of metal are commonly used for downspouts? Common options include aluminum, copper, and steel, each offering different levels of durability and aesthetic appeal.
Can metal downspouts be customized to match a property's exterior? Yes, they can be painted or finished in various colors and styles to complement the property's design.
What projects typically involve metal downspout installation? Installation is often requested for new construction, replacement of old or damaged downspouts, or upgrades to improve drainage and curb appeal.
